The specific implementation mode is as follows:
example 1:
the utility model provides a totally enclosed grab bucket, this kind of totally enclosed grab bucket includes the double jaw lamella bucket body 8 that two left and right symmetrical fill lamella 12 constitute, the lock is in the same place in the middle of two fill lamellas, the adjacent one side of fill lamella be connected through middle round pin axle 9 with lower bolster 10, the opposite side of fill lamella pass through vaulting pole round pin axle 7 with the lower extreme of vaulting pole 4 and be connected, the upper end of vaulting pole articulated with upper bolster 2, the front and back side of fill lamella upper end on weld trapezoidal curb plate 6 respectively, two trapezoidal curb plate between the welding have apron 5.
Example 2:
according to the totally enclosed grab bucket of embodiment 1, the upper pulley 3 of the upper bolster is connected with the lower pulley 11 of the lower bolster through a steel wire rope.
The bridge type grab ship unloader lifts the whole device through the hoisting chain 1 during hoisting, the upper pulley is connected with the lower pulley through a steel wire rope, power equipment is arranged on the upper pulley, the upper pulley is controlled by the power equipment to rotate so as to realize that the steel wire rope is wound on the upper pulley and is wound out of the upper pulley, thus the change of the distance between the upper pulley and the lower pulley can be realized, and the opening and the grabbing action between two bucket petals can be realized.
